
Buying a product with an unknown Chinese brand can sometimes bring you an unwanted surprise and not to mention some additional headaches or even serious problems. A fresh example I had was with such product was an ExpressCard reader for Compact Flash cards that I picked up because of the very attractive price it had. Of course the product worked without any problems, or at least most of the time, there were just a few times that my laptop froze when inserting the reader. So I decided to open it up and see if there is any problem with it that might be causing the freezes and imagine my surprise when I’ve found the piece of solder on the picture above freely moving inside the case of the reader. I was quite happy that it did not do any serious damage to my laptop besides the few times it froze up the PC without any permanent damage. But if I was not lucky enough it could’ve shorted something important and could result in my laptop being seriously damaged, so next time when buying some item like that I’ll have this in mind…
